City Hall City of La Crosse, Wisconsin 400 La Crosse Street La Crosse, WI 54601 Meeting Minutes - Final Judiciary & Administration Committee Tuesday, January 6, 2026 4:00 PM Council Chambers City Hall, First Floor Call To Order Chair Mindel called the meeting to order at 4:02 p.m. Roll Call CM Bedford arrived at 4:03 p.m. Present: 7 - Crystal Bedford, Gary Padesky, Jennifer Trost, Lisa Weston, Mackenzie Mindel, Olivia Stine,Tamra Dickinson Agenda Items: 25-1370 Resolution rescinding Resolution No. 2009-08-022 and discontinuing invocation procedures for Common Council meetings. A motion was made by Padesky, seconded by Weston, to OPEN public hearing. The motion carried unanimously. The following spoke: Maureen Freedland, Robert Freedland, Bryan McGrath, Diana McGrath, Tim Trailer, Tom Sweeney, Shannon McKinney, Kael Clemmerson, and Mario Hristov. A motion was made by Weston, seconded by Padesky, to CLOSE public hearing. The motion carried unanimously. A motion was made by Mindel, seconded by Dickinson, that the Resolution be RECOMMENDED TO BE ADOPTED to the Common Council on 1/8/2026. The motion carried by the following vote: Yes: 5- Trost, Weston, Mindel, Stine,Dickinson No: 1- Padesky Abstain: 1- Bedford City of La Crosse, Wisconsin Page 1 Judiciary & Administration Meeting Minutes - Final January 6, 2026 Committee 25-1405 AN ORDINANCE to amend Subsection 115-110 of the Code of Ordinances of the City of La Crosse by transferring certain property from the Residence District to the Special Residence District, allowing for the property at 1701 Onalaska Ave. & 1509 Rublee St. to return to use as a triplex. A motion was made by Trost, seconded by Dickinson, that the Ordinance be RECOMMENDED TO BE ADOPTED to the Common Council on 1/8/2026. The motion carried by the following vote: Yes: 7- Bedford, Padesky, Trost, Weston, Mindel, Stine,Dickinson 25-1469 AN ORDINANCE to amend Secs. 10-393 and 10-394 of the Code of Ordinances of the City of La Crosse to include definitions and an exemption for community pantries on private property. Council member Padesky was excused from the meeting at 4:41 p.m. A motion was made by Trost, seconded by Bedford, that the Ordinance be RECOMMENDED TO BE ADOPTED to the Common Council on 1/8/2026. The motion carried by the following vote: Yes: 6- Bedford, Trost, Weston, Mindel, Stine,Dickinson Excused: 1- Padesky 25-1471 Resolution requesting that the Wisconsin Department of Transportation develop additional project alternatives for the Highway 53 Corridor Study that maintain on-street parking and add bicycle facilities. A motion was made by Bedford, seconded by Mindel, to OPEN public hearing. The motion carried unanimously. The following spoke: Paul Leithold & Kevin Hundt. A motion was made by Trost, seconded by Weston, to CLOSE public hearing. The motion carried unanimously. A motion was made by Weston, seconded by Trost, that the Resolution be RECOMMENDED TO BE ADOPTED to the Common Council on 1/8/2026. The motion carried by the following vote: Yes: 4- Trost, Weston, Mindel,Stine No: 2- Bedford,Dickinson Excused: 1- Padesky City of La Crosse, Wisconsin Page 2 Judiciary & Administration Meeting Minutes - Final January 6, 2026 Committee 26-0002 Resolution granting various license applications pursuant to Chapters 4, 6, and/or 10 of the La Crosse Municipal Code for the license period 2025-2026 (January). A motion was made by Weston, seconded by Dickinson, that the Application be RECOMMENDED RESOLUTION APPROVING THE SAME to the Common Council on 1/8/2026. The motion carried by the following vote: Yes: 6- Bedford, Trost, Weston, Mindel, Stine,Dickinson Excused: 1- Padesky Adjournment Meeting adjourned at 5:22 p.m. City of La Crosse, Wisconsin Page 3
